§ 25-10. Cessation of township organization. If it appears by the returns of the election that a majority of the votes in at least three-fourths of the townships, containing at least a majority of the population in the county, cast on the question of the continuance of township organization at the election are against the continuance of township organization, then township organization shall cease in the county as soon as a county board is elected and qualified. All laws relating to counties not under township organization shall be applicable to the county, the same as if township organization had never been adopted in it.
